K2, also known as synthetic marijuana, represents a significant public health crisis . It's not actual cannabis , but rather a blend of dried, vegetation sprayed with dangerous compounds that mimic the effects of THC, the intoxicating ingredient in marijuana . These substances are often produced in clandestine labs and their strength can vary greatly , making them incredibly unpredictable and resulting in severe physical effects , including psychosis and even passing. The widespread availability of K2 poses a major threat to users, particularly young individuals and highlights the need for increased education and effective response strategies.

Spice and K2: Why These "Weed" Alternatives Are So Harmful

These fake herbs, often marketed as “Spice,” “K2,” or similar brands, are far from marijuana, despite what dealers might suggest. They contain harmful chemicals sprayed onto dried plant matter, and unlike natural cannabis, their effects are incredibly erratic. Users often experience severe health problems, including fits, delusions, fear, increased pulse, nausea, and even renal issues. The ingredients used in k2 liquid spice these products vary frequently, making it impossible to know what one is consuming, and thus, impossible to predict the effects. Here's a breakdown of the risks:

  • Unregulated Production: These compounds are manufactured in illegal labs with no quality control.
  • Potency Issues: The concentration can vary wildly from batch to batch.
  • Unknown Chemicals: The components are often undisclosed and potentially extremely dangerous.
  • Addiction Risk: Dependence is possible quickly and withdrawal indications can be severe.

Ultimately, using Spice or K2 is a risky gamble with one's life.
